当前位置: 首页 > 产品大全 > Java计算机毕业设计 助农特色农产品销售系统——开题报告、源码与论文全攻略

Java计算机毕业设计 助农特色农产品销售系统——开题报告、源码与论文全攻略

Java计算机毕业设计 助农特色农产品销售系统——开题报告、源码与论文全攻略

随着乡村振兴战略的深入推进,特色农产品销售已成为助农增收的关键环节。本项目旨在设计并实现一个基于Java的“助农特色农产品销售系统”,以数字化手段连接农户与消费者,优化销售渠道,提升农产品附加值,为农业现代化提供技术支撑。

一、开题报告核心内容

  1. 项目背景与意义:分析当前特色农产品销售面临的挑战,如信息不对称、流通环节多、品牌影响力弱等,阐述系统在促进产销对接、保障农户收益、满足消费者需求方面的重要价值。
  2. 系统目标:构建一个集商品展示、在线交易、订单管理、物流跟踪、用户评价与数据分析于一体的B2C电商平台,支持农户自主入驻与管理,消费者便捷采购。
  3. 技术选型:采用Java EE或Spring Boot作为后端框架,MySQL数据库存储数据,前端使用HTML5+CSS3+JavaScript(可选Vue.js或React),部署于Tomcat服务器,确保系统稳定性与可扩展性。
  4. 创新点:融入农产品溯源功能,通过二维码展示生产信息;设计个性化推荐算法,提升用户体验;结合社交媒体分享,增强品牌传播。
  5. 实施计划:分需求分析、系统设计、编码实现、测试优化、论文撰写五个阶段,预计周期为4-6个月。

二、源码开发要点

  1. 模块划分
  • 用户模块:农户与消费者注册登录、权限管理。
  • 商品模块:农产品分类、详情展示、库存管理。
  • 交易模块:购物车、订单生成、支付接口集成(如支付宝/微信)。
  • 后台管理模块:数据监控、用户审核、销售统计。
  1. 关键技术实现
  • 使用Spring MVC或Spring Cloud构建微服务架构,提高系统灵活性。
  • 数据库设计遵循三范式,建立商品、订单、用户等核心表关系。
  • 集成Redis缓存热点数据,提升系统响应速度。
  • 实现文件上传功能,支持农产品图片与溯源资料展示。

三、论文撰写指南

  1. 结构建议
  • 绪论:阐述研究背景、目的及国内外相关系统对比。
  • 需求分析:通过用例图、流程图详细说明功能与非功能需求。
  • 系统设计:包括架构设计、数据库设计、界面设计。
  • 系统实现:展示核心代码片段与功能界面截图。
  • 系统测试:描述测试用例与性能优化结果。
  • 与展望:归纳成果,提出改进方向。
  1. 重点内容
  • 突出“助农”特色,分析系统对农村经济的实际影响。
  • 详细记录开发过程中遇到的问题及解决方案。
  • 结合数据图表展示系统应用效果,如交易量增长、用户满意度等。

四、计算机系统服务部署与维护

  1. 部署方案
  • 推荐使用阿里云、腾讯云等云服务器,配置Linux环境(如CentOS)。
  • 通过Docker容器化部署,简化环境依赖与迁移流程。
  • 设置Nginx反向代理与负载均衡,保障高并发访问。
  1. 维护建议
  • 定期备份数据库,监控系统日志,防范安全风险。
  • 提供用户培训与技术支持,确保农户能熟练操作系统。
  • 根据反馈持续迭代功能,如增加直播带货模块或移动端APP。

本系统不仅可作为高校计算机专业的毕业设计实践,更具备实际应用潜力,能为乡村振兴注入科技动力。开发过程中需注重代码规范与文档完整性,确保项目从开题到落地的顺利进行。

如若转载,请注明出处:http://www.hubangkj.com/product/50.html

更新时间:2026-01-13 19:07:11

产品列表

PRODUCT